Greedfall studio Spiders' liquidation is a "premeditated and deliberate choice by Nacon’s management" claim union as they call for a boycott
The French video game union STJV claims that the liquidation of Greedfall 2 developer Spiders is a deliberate choice by publisher Nacon's management, not a result of the studio's profitability. The union alleges Nacon engaged in financial arrangements that left Spiders as an 'empty shell' and prevented it from securing new contracts or external funding, leading to the termination of 71 workers. The STJV is calling for a boycott of Nacon.
